نمایش نتایج 1 تا 8 از 8

نام تاپیک: handle کردن یک فرم ساده با php

  1. #1

    handle کردن یک فرم ساده با php

    سلام
    من خوندن php تازه شروع کردم . یک اشکال ابتدایی و شاید خنده دار!
    میخوام یک فورم حاوی چند تا input را handle کنم . در فایل دوم که handle.php باشه متغیر های input رو نمیشناسه و خالی چاپ می کنه یا خالی وارد mysql میکنه . وقتی متدget باشه هم حتی متغییر ها را دقیق بالا نشون میده اما بازم .....

    پیغام "Notice: Undefined variable ....................." می داد که من با تبدیل
    "error_reporting = E_ALL به
    error_reporting = E_ALL & ~E_NOTICE tabdil kardam"
    برداشتم ولی مشکلی رو که حل نمی کنه فقط پیغام رو نشون نمیده

    در ضمن من فکر می کنم syntax ها همه درسته ....
    نمیدونم چرا مقادیر متغییر های فرم به فایل handle.php منتقل نمیشه؟؟؟؟؟؟؟؟؟؟

  2. #2
    کاربر دائمی آواتار tabib_m
    تاریخ عضویت
    تیر 1384
    محل زندگی
    ایران - قم
    پست
    1,268
    سلام.
    کد فرمتون رو بذارید تا اشکال معلوم شه.

  3. #3

    Question

    اینجا که همه انگلیس ها راست چین میشه


    فایل ها رو فرستادم

    ممنون ، خیلی هم ممنون
    فایل های ضمیمه فایل های ضمیمه

  4. #4
    کدت در صورتی که register_globals در php.ini روشن باشه بدون ایراد کار می کنه

    برای استفاده از مقدار های ارسالی از فرمت از

    POST:
    $HTTP_POST_VARS['input_name']
    $_POST['input_name']
    GET:
    $HTTP_GET_VARS['input_name']
    $_GET['input_name']

    استفاده کن

    ----------------------------------------------
    ابتدای کدت [code] و انتهاش [code/] قرار بده

  5. #5

    Unhappy

    REGISTER_GLOBAL را ON کردم فرقی نمی کنه!
    از HTTP_POST_VAR هم استفاده می کنم ولی بازهم مقادیر ارسال نمی شوند و متغییر ها در فرم HANDLE دارای مقدار نیستند!
    دیگه نمی دونم چکاری بکنم!
    با EASYPHP کار می کنم اما توی لینوکس هم همین مشکل رو دارم!

  6. #6
    از HTTP_POST_VAR هم استفاده می کنم ولی بازهم مقادیر ارسال نمی شوند
    با استفاده از اینا شما نمی تونید مقداری ارسال منید بلکه از مقادیر ارسالی از فرمتون می تونید استفاده کنید
    ولی یک منبع top می خوام بهت معرفی کنم:
    منبع جامع و کامل php

  7. #7

    Unhappy

    اینکه این طوری گفتم اشتباه لفظی بود دقیقا میدونم HTTP_POST_VAR چطوری کار می کنه .
    من کدی که توی هر کتابی و ... نوشته شده را می نویسم و کار نمیده !
    کد هم فرستادم !
    فکر کنم بر میگرده به تنظیمات فایل php.ini
    در ضمن register_global هم on هست !

  8. #8

    <form method="get" action="http://localhost/Farzanegan/db.php" >

    use $_GET

تاپیک های مشابه

  1. پیدا کردن یک Handle
    نوشته شده توسط rostamkhani در بخش برنامه نویسی در 6 VB
    پاسخ: 8
    آخرین پست: سه شنبه 09 بهمن 1386, 03:05 صبح
  2. handle کردن با موس
    نوشته شده توسط astudio در بخش Java SE : نگارش استاندارد جاوا
    پاسخ: 0
    آخرین پست: شنبه 13 مرداد 1386, 12:46 عصر
  3. یه مشکل با Handle
    نوشته شده توسط DAMAVAND در بخش مباحث عمومی دلفی و پاسکال
    پاسخ: 4
    آخرین پست: دوشنبه 21 خرداد 1386, 12:03 عصر
  4. پیدا کردن handle و نام یک دکمه از برنامه دیگر
    نوشته شده توسط حبیب در بخش برنامه نویسی در 6 VB
    پاسخ: 1
    آخرین پست: چهارشنبه 13 اردیبهشت 1385, 21:33 عصر
  5. HANDLE
    نوشته شده توسط yamne_h در بخش برنامه نویسی با زبان C و ++C
    پاسخ: 1
    آخرین پست: چهارشنبه 17 اسفند 1384, 23:59 عصر

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•